Claymore (TV)

Info: 2007.04.03, 2007.09.25, TV (26 episode(s) at 23 minutes each)
2007 saw the anime Claymore TV release based on the manga Claymore by Norihiro Yagi released in 2001. Hiroyuki Tanaka was the director. The Claymore TV soundtrack belongs to Masanori Takumi also known for music to Genshiken TV. The series consists of 23-minute episodes totaling to 26. The anime is filmed as a action with slight adventure, drama, fantasy.
